The real story of 4/20: Marijuana has lasting long-term developmental effects on adolescents. It impairs short-term memory, slows learning, impairs lung function and can have lasting serious effects such as cancer and lung disease. Adolescents who use marijuana can also have weakened immune responses and adverse effects on heart function.
